Andrew Lang's 'The Fairy Books of All Colours - Complete Series' is a collection of fairy tales from various cultures, each compiled into a distinct colored book set. Known for his wide-ranging intellectual interests and folkloric expertise, Lang presents these timeless stories in a beautifully written and engaging manner, making them accessible to readers of all ages. The books are not only entertaining but also serve as a valuable resource for studying the similarities and differences in folklore across different traditions. Lang's literary style is both elegant and informative, bringing life to these magical tales in a way that captivates the imagination of readers. With its extensive coverage of folklore and fairy tales, this collection stands as a seminal work in the field of comparative mythology and children's literature. Andrew Lang, a Scottish writer and folklorist, was deeply passionate about preserving and sharing traditional folk tales. His dedication to compiling and retelling these stories stems from his belief in the importance of passing down cultural heritage through oral and written traditions. Lang's scholarly background and love for storytelling are evident in 'The Fairy Books of All Colours', showcasing his commitment to preserving the richness of world folklore for generations to come. Good Press presents to you this meticulously edited Andrew Lang's Complete Fairy Book Collection of classic fairytales, myths and folk tales. This epic collection includes the tales from Norse mythology, Arabian Nights, myths of American Indians, Australian Bushmen and African Kaffirs. The collections presents the greatest French, Spanish, Russian, Danish, Norwegian fairytales, Sicilian traditional tales, as well as stories from Persia, Lapland, Brazil, India, Romania, Serbia, Japan, China, Lithuania, Africa and Portugal...among others. The Green Fairy Book is the third in the Langs' Fairy Books series, and it consists of 42 short stories and epic tales, mainly from Spanish and Chinese traditions.
